Stranded Customer REC Adder Rationale Document

Stranded customers are those who have signed a contract with a solar company and then the AV (and sometimes also the Designee) goes out of business or is prevented from moving forward with the project.. In response to AV and Designee feedback that assisting stranded customers is often unattractive, as the work and risk can outweigh the benefits, the Agency will implement an economic incentive for AVs that assist stranded customers in the form of a REC Adder – an increased price in the REC Contract for RECs generated by projects that were “unstranded.” On September 3, 2025, the Agency issued a Rationale Document, outlining its final decisions on this policy and explaining whether and how stakeholder feedback was incorporated, and also published the associated chart of stranded customer categories, both of which can be found on the Consumer Protection Initiatives page. The Agency and Program Administrator intend to launch the Stranded Customer REC Adder in the coming weeks.
